Abstract

The purpose of the study was to determine the coated carbide tool surface topography. The study included determining detailed identification of wear mechanisms occurring on the rake face and major flank in the process of turning the DSS. The results of wear occurring on the tool both points were compared for the period of the steady-state wear of the tool point. Occurrence of various mechanisms, such as abrasive wear, was proven. Scanning Electron Microscopy SEM and Infinite Focus optical device for 3D surface measurement were used for the wear analysis.
